Article Nanoscience & Nanotechnology

Nanocomposite Photoanodes Consisting of p-NiO/n-ZnO Heterojunction and Carbon Quantum Dot Additive for Dye-Sensitized Solar Cells

Tesfaye Abebe Geleta et al.

Summary: In this study, nanocomposites of n-ZnO and p-NiO were used as photoanodes in DSSCs, and the addition of carbon quantum dots significantly improved the efficiency of solar cells. The p-n heterojunction between NiO and ZnO semiconductors facilitated faster charge separation and reduced electron recombination. Additionally, the doping of carbon quantum dots promoted charge carrier transport and reduced potential barriers at the interfaces, contributing to the enhancement of photovoltaic performance.
